Google uses complex algorithms to determine search rankings. By understanding how these algorithms work, you can tailor your SEO strategies accordingly. Key factors include keyword relevance, site speed, and mobile optimization.
Effective keyword research is the foundation of any successful SEO strategy. Use tools like Google Keyword Planner and Ahrefs to identify relevant keywords that your target audience is searching for.
On-page SEO refers to the practice of optimizing individual web pages. This includes optimizing title tags, meta descriptions, and header tags, as well as ensuring your content is high-quality and engaging.
Search engines favor content that provides value to users. Ensure your articles are informative, engaging, and well-researched. Use visuals and multimedia to enhance user experience and increase dwell time on your pages.
Off-page SEO involves activities you do outside of your website to improve its position in search rankings. This includes link building and social media engagement. Building high-quality backlinks is crucial as it signals to Google that your site is credible and authoritative.
Engaging with your audience on social media can drive traffic to your site and improve your SEO efforts. Share your content on platforms like Facebook, Twitter, and LinkedIn to increase visibility.
It's essential to track your SEO performance to understand what's working and what needs improvement. Utilize tools like Google Analytics and Search Console to monitor your site’s traffic and ranking positions.
